Ant nests are commonly located in soil beneath stones, concrete paths, walls, and similar structures. During late summer, and occasionally at other times of the year, swarms of winged male and female ants emerge to mate and disperse. Ants generally consume sweet, sugary foods, although some species may also feed on fats and meat products.


New Zealand hosts native ant species, but the most problematic ones are primarily imported. Examples include the White Footed Ant, Argentine Ant, and Darwin's Ant. Different regions within New Zealand encounter various nuisance species. Therefore, it is crucial to identify the specific ant species present to ensure appropriate treatment. Incorrect identification or advice can lead to more persistent issues.
